Understanding the Reasons Behind Delayed Payouts
To comprehend the issue of payout delays, it’s essential to unpack the various factors contributing to this problem. From operational inefficiencies to regulatory requirements, these delays can arise from numerous sources.
Verification Processes
One primary reason for delays is the verification process that casinos implement to prevent fraud and ensure compliance with gambling regulations. Players often must submit identification documents, financial statements, and other sensitive information. While these measures are necessary for security, they can extend the payout timeline significantly.
Bank Processing Times
Another critical element is the time it takes for banks and financial institutions to process transactions. Casinos often initiate withdrawals promptly, but banks may take several days (or even longer) to finalize these transfers. This waiting period can lead to frustration for players eager to access their winnings.

How Players Can Protect Themselves
While players cannot control the internal processes of casinos, they can take steps to protect themselves from unnecessary delays. First and foremost, players should carefully read the terms and conditions outlined by the casino regarding payouts.
Selecting Reputable Casinos
Choosing a reputable casino is crucial. Players should seek out platforms with a solid track record of timely payouts and positive reviews from other users. Researching different online casinos can go a long way in ensuring a smoother gaming experience.
Ensuring Proper Documentation
It’s also beneficial for players to ensure that they have all the required documentation ready before attempting to withdraw funds. Having identification and proof of payment methods at hand can expedite the verification process, leading to quicker payouts.
